Makes you happy/horny/laugh or otherwise greatly affected.
You rock my face off!
Do you like Alkaline Trio? They rock my face off! Yeah I screwed Chris, he rocked my face off!
by Dsay Diane Nev October 24, 2003
This means that it is VERY cool and I enjoy it much. :D
That horse rocks my face off!
by Phsyco biotch August 22, 2003